Fieldbus/Ethernet Conformance
HMS policy is that all Anybus
products, where applicable, shall be tested and
verified for Fieldbus/Ethernet conformance. This
is normally a test done by the specific fieldbus
organisation, but can also in some specific cases
be a HMS verification done with a tool recommended
by the fieldbus organisation or with help of reference
customers. The reason for this certification or
pre-certification is that HMS want to verify that
all modules follow the specification of the different
fieldbuses and that our embedded modules will pass
a product certification done by our customer, using
our embedded module as the fieldbus interface.

Most fieldbus organisations have third party test labs to test and verify that
each fieldbus product is compliant with the standard and follow the interoperability
expectations when used with other vendors products. HMS works closely with each
organisation to make sure that all our products meet the specifications and pass
each test. HMS has made over 100 fieldbus Conformance Certifications tests for
HMS products as well as helping our customers to get a fieldbus conformity for
their products.
CE & UL Certification
Anybus
and CE mark
The CE mark has its origin in the European Community. Since 1996 it is a legal requirement of all electronic products used on the European Market. For Electronic/Electric products the EMC directive (EMC = Electro Magnetic Compatibility) is mandatory for end customer products.
Anybus is viewed as an embedded component, and as a component the CE mark is not mandatory. However, the HMS policy is that the product shall be pre-tested according to the CE requirements. This makes the use of Anybus much easier and more reliable for our customers; due to the fact that the module itself is pre-tested
HMS has the equipment to perform some of the required CE test in-house. For the remaining test we use professional external EMC test laboratories.
Anybus
and UL Marking
The Anybus Embedded product range has been UL and cUL recognized by UL (Underwriters Laboratories Inc).The tests have been performed according to the standard for industrial control equipment, UL508, with Anybus being regarded as a component in the Programmable Controller category. The fact that Anybus is UL recognized simplifies the integration of Anybus to products and applications that are or will be UL listed. A UL approval means that UL has tested and evaluated samples of the product and determined that they meet the UL requirements. In addition, products are periodically checked by UL at the manufacturing facility to make sure they continue to meet the UL requirements.
